MOVIETONE CARD TITLE: Old Bridge Blasted. DESCRIPTION: An old bridge near Aachen in Germany has been replaced by a new one, so the old one’s being blown down. The charges are placed in such a way that the old structure falls the right way without harming the new bridge which is just a few yards away. SHOTLIST: Pictures show a bridge at Alsdorf being blasted. Alongside the old bridge a new one was built to keep the traffic flowing. The difficulty in blasting was to be careful not to damage the new bridge, as it was standing so close to the old. But as pictures show the demolition squad under Mr George Werner did their job perfectly.
